Rihanna will have a street in her hometown of Saint Michael, Barbados named after her. 

The Bajan bad girl never forgot her roots, and over the years has done a ton for the Caribbean country, from fundraising and charity work to taking part in international tourism campaigns. And soon, a piece of the island will bear her name. The street formerly known as Westbury New Road will be re-christened Rihanna Drive.

This past Friday, the Government of Barbados Ministry of Tourism announced, “The Government of Barbados will on Independence Day, Thursday November 30th...officially change the name of Westbury New Road located in St. Michael to Rihanna Drive in honor of Barbadian superstar Ms. Robyn Rihanna Fenty, who grew up in Westbury New Road.”

On Barbados’s Independence day, Rihanna and the Prime Minister of Barbados, Freundel Stuart, will be present for the two-hour ceremony to unveil the street’s new signage. (Nation News)
